Stock Photo - A Multicolored Asian Lady Beetle Harmonia axyridis perched on a leaf, Promised Land State Park, Greentown, Pike County, Pennsylvania, USA

Stock Photo: A Multicolored Asian Lady Beetle Harmonia axyridis perched on a leaf, Promised Land State Park, Greentown, Pike County, Pennsylvania, USA.

Searchable keywords

Choose multiple keywords